
BH Murtal asks for help: Ryanair flew in a corona case
The Murtal District Authority is asking the Austrian population for help. On September 29, 2020, a person who tested positive for the coronavirus traveled from Seville to Vienna on Ryanair flight FR 7337 in seat 27B. The traveler then traveled from Schwechat Airport to Vienna Central Station using a Railjet. The journey continued at around 18:00 p.m. on an ÖBB train that arrived in Judenburg at 21:00 p.m. There was no assigned seat. The Murtal District Authority is asking people who were on board the Ryanair flight and/or in the two Austrian Federal Railways trains to monitor their own health and voluntarily avoid social contacts and crowds until October 9, 2020 inclusive. The Murtal District Authority is also requesting that anyone experiencing symptoms contact the local health authority and the hotline 1450. In this context, it should also be noted that contact persons residing in Vienna have the opportunity to be tested free of charge in front of the Ernst Happel Stadium and on the Danube Island.
